Egyptian FM Meets Eritrean President to Strengthen Bilateral Ties

Egypt’s Foreign Minister recently met with Eritrean President to deliver an official message, marking a significant step in strengthening diplomatic ties between the two nations. This high-level meeting emphasized bilateral cooperation, regional stability, economic development, and security collaboration, reinforcing both countries’ commitment to fostering strong diplomatic relations.This engagement aligns with broader foreign policy objectives, ensuring that Egypt and Eritrea maintain a strategic partnership that benefits both economies while contributing to political stability and security efforts in the Horn of Africa.

Enhancing Egypt-Eritrea Diplomatic Relations

Egypt and Eritrea have long shared historical, political, and economic ties, and this meeting highlighted the ongoing efforts to strengthen their bilateral engagement. Discussions focused on expanding trade, investment, infrastructure development, and security cooperation, ensuring a stable and prosperous future for both nations.The visit reflects Egypt’s broader foreign policy strategy of engaging with African nations to foster regional peace, stability, and economic growth. Strengthening diplomatic relations with Eritrea is part of a wider geopolitical approach, ensuring economic partnerships and security collaboration remain at the forefront of bilateral ties.
